    Go with a brand like APEX, Turner, etc.
    Not everyone agrees, but I really like the way stud conversion looks. Only reason I opted out of it was because the 75mm kits were going to be too long for the way my wheels are shaped. CH or Arc-8s are a little more "stud-friendly." Someone is selling a brand new APEX 75mm kit over on M3forum right now for $100 shipped, which is about a $35 discount.
